They may seem more synonymous with hotter places like Tenerife and Crete, but back in the 1990s Greater London and its surrounds were packed full of water parks including Floridian-style sky-high slides in Chingford and Dartford. ‘Pipe Dreams’ is a nostalgic love letter to these watery community spaces, many of which now no longer exsist. Created by artist Madeleine Famurewa and author, broadcaster and freelance journalist Jimi Famurewa, the exhibition is a mixture of soundscapes, large-scale drawings and installation, evoking these leisure pools in the South East and exploring what they meant to the people who visited. 

Alongside the exhibition, look out for a community-minded program of events, including family workshops and talks on the benefits of swimming. A separate evening event, ‘Open Water’, will feature a panel discussion about the importance of accessibility and inclusivity in swimming culture.
